Nov 13, 2023 · Below is the list of important regulatory dates for all orphan drugs for 2023. Prescription Drug User Fee Act (PDUFA) dates refer to deadlines for the FDA to review new drugs. The PDUFA date is 10 months after the drug application has been accepted by the FDA or 6 months, if the drug is given a priority review designation.

The U.S. Food and Drug Administration's "This Is Our Watch" initiative is a national retailer education program to raise awareness among ...As of December 31, 2021, FDA has converted 50% of accelerated approvals (139) to traditional approval based on studies that have confirmed clinical benefit. For these conversions, the median time from accelerated approval to traditional approval was 3.2 years. In the last decade, 51 of the accelerated approvals were converted in a median time ...
